Quebec MP and former Canadian astronaut Marc Garneau outlined the advantages Canada brings on Friday as the government prepares to green-light space launches on a “case-by-case” basis. He said Canada boasts “a large open territory for space launches, which must be far from populated areas and “a lot of high inclination orbits.”
